2010년 7월 16일 금요일

Python - Python 2.4 버전에서 SimpleXMLRPCServer allow_none 문제

Python 2.4 버전에서

SimpleXMLRPCServer 사용해서

클라이언트에서 실행시

'cannot marshal None unless allow_none is enabled'

위 와 같은 메시지가 나온다면

python 라이브러리에서 xmlrpclib.py 열어서

allow_none 부분을 찾아서 값을 1 로 변경해주면 된다.


* 참고로 2.5 버전에서는 fix 됬다고 함

0 개의 댓글:

댓글 쓰기